CAPRI, Italy - G7 powers are determined to bolster Ukraine's air defences, their foreign ministers said on Friday after repeated Russian air strikes which have wrecked power infrastructure and killed hundreds.

"We are determined to continue to provide military, financial, political, humanitarian, economic, and development support to Ukraine and its people," they added. "When it comes to Russia's defense industrial base, the primary contributor in this moment ... is China," Blinken said. Another key funding issue under review is how to use profits from some $300 billion of sovereign Russian assets held in the West to help Ukraine, as EU member states hesitate over concerns about the legality of such a move.
